## Tuning

FeeCrafter's rules engine decides shipping fees per order, and yes, the defaults are opinionated. If a merchant on the Parcelgrove plan complains about weird surcharges, it's almost always one of the knobs below rather than a bug. Changing a value takes effect on the next rule reload, so no restart needed — just don't crank the distance multiplier without checking with eng. Current defaults follow.

tuning table, kageg-kagap:
CAPS = {
    "druox": 842,
    "quenax": 605,
    "zormir": 107,
    "tamwyn": 577,
    "kasok": 688,
}

## Deploying the Gatewick Proctor Queue

Deploys are pretty painless: push to main, wait for the pipeline, then watch the queue drain dashboard for five minutes. If candidates pile up mid-exam, roll back first and ask questions later — the queue replays safely. Everything the workers care about lives in one config block, shown here for reference.

settings of bafof-yagef:
JOROX_PIN=8740
JOROX_TENANT=pelox
JOROX_METRICS_HOST=metrics.jorox.qorvelworks.internal
JOROX_SEAL=seal_c78f63c1
JOROX_STANDBY_TEAM=norax

**Action item (Duskmere digest incident):** The digest scheduler double-fired because the cron tick and the catch-up sweep overlapped after the Hallowell maintenance window. Future maintainers: the fix adds a lease lock plus jittered start times. Don't tune these by instinct; they interact. The current values were load-tested and are recorded below for reference.

tuning table, yajog-yahof:
BUDGETS = {
    "lamvan": 303,
    "wenox": 460,
    "fenvan": 525,
}

## Configuration

Snapshot tests for Quillframe components run via `qf snap`. Set `QF_SNAP_DIR` to the writable cache path and `QF_SNAP_STRICT=1` in CI. Stale snapshots fail the build; regenerate with `qf snap --update`. No network access is needed except for the baseline store, whose access credential goes on the following line of the env file.

env line for fafof-fahag: LEDGER_TOKEN5=f8790